Abstract

The utility model provides multifunctional three-leaf bone holding forceps comprising an upper forceps arm and a lower forceps arm which are hinged with each other. The front end of the upper forceps arm and the lower forceps arm is a clamping portion which comprises a long clamping tooth arranged at the front end of the upper forceps arm and two short clamping teeth arranged at the front end of the lower forceps arm, the two short clamping teeth are parallelly arranged, and a sliding hole is longitudinally arranged in the middle of each of the long clamping tooth and the short clamping teeth. By arranging the sliding holes of the long clamping tooth and the short clamping teeth in the clamping portion, Kirschner wires can be put into a bone fracture end after resetting through the sliding holes to maintain temporary resetting of the bone fracture end, and the reset bone fracture end does not shift again when a steel plate is placed at the bone fracture end. Compared with the prior art, the multifunctional three-leaf bone holding forceps have the advantages that repeated bone fracture restitution can be avoided, bleeding amount and operative wounds of a patient can be reduced, and operative time can be reduced.

Background technology
Bone holding forceps are widely used in Following Orthopaedic Procedures:, and its effect is to maintain the reduction of the fracture, plays temporary fixed effect.If using steel plate internal skeleton is fixed, because blocking steel plate, bone holding forceps insert, have to abandon the fracture that reduction puts in place, put steel plate reduction fracture again behind bony surface appropriate location, after reduction success, application bone holding forceps are together fixing together with steel plate, sclerotin.So just can not and fix and synchronously carry out fracture end reduction, when fracture end is placed steel plate, can make the fracture end resetting again be shifted, increase patient's amount of bleeding and operation wound, both waste valuable operating time, often make again the reduction of the fracture owe desirable.

The specific embodiment
Below in conjunction with the accompanying drawing in this utility model, the technical scheme in this utility model is clearly and completely described.
Figure 1 shows that the structural representation of the multi-functional SANYE bone holding forceps of this utility model, described multi-functional SANYE bone holding forceps comprise upper tong arm 1 and the lower tong arm 2 being hinged, the front end of upper tong arm 1 and lower tong arm 2 is clamping part, and described clamping part comprises a long clip tooth 3 that is located at tong arm 1 front end and two short clip tooths 4 that are located at lower tong arm 2 front ends.Described long clip tooth 3 and short clip tooth 4 are arcuate structure, and two short clip tooths 4 are arranged in parallel.The middle part of described long clip tooth 3 and short clip tooth 4 is longitudinally provided with respectively slide opening 5, and as shown in Figure 1, slide opening 5 extends inwardly to medium position from the end of long clip tooth 3 and short clip tooth 4.Described long clip tooth 3 and short clip tooth 4 form SANYE pawl formula, and hold is more comprehensive and even.The wide footpath of the slide opening 5 of long clip tooth 3 is 5mm, and the wide footpath of the slide opening 5 of short clip tooth 4 is 4mm.
In the grip part of upper tong arm 1, be provided with screw rod 6, after the through hole that screw rod 6 passes on lower tong arm 2 grip parts, be threaded with bolt 7.
This utility model operational approach: routine operation method reaches fracture segment end, after reduction is fractured successfully, apply multi-functional SANYE bone holding forceps one or two fixing, avoid putting steel plate position, between fracture two sections of ends, sclerite and Duan Duan, row Kirschner wire is fixed.Because long clip tooth 3 and short clip tooth 4 in this utility model clamping part are provided with slide opening 5, for successfully piercing, Kirschner wire provide sky to ask, the stationary conduit of different directions, many pieces of pins can also be provided simultaneously, for maintain fracture reduction, provide powerful guarantee to line temporarily, then exit bone holding forceps, retain Kirschner wire, putting steel plate is fixed on sclerotin in reserved location, finally pull out Kirschner wire, internal fixation finishes, and can avoid compared to existing technology repeatedly reduction fracture.
In this utility model clamping part, long clip tooth 3 and short clip tooth 4 are provided with the design of slide opening 5, when being screwed separately butterfly slide block, provide best screw entry point passage.
